As Treasury Manager, you will be responsible for managing staff and coordinating resources in a full spectrum of treasury processing and reporting efforts. You will frequently interact with internal and external systems and support staff, spearhead banking requests, and drive ERP and application-based technical initiatives. You will manage extensive processing of bank documentation for multiple domestic and international entities, including the complex opening of international accounts and periodic Know Your Customer (KYC) requirements. You will be responsible for reconciliations relating to cash and investments, with an emphasis on understanding and disseminating cash management controls and documenting these in written and visual formats. Frequent communication with banking and brokerage business partners is required, particularly concerning international issues.
Responsibilities
· Serve as primary technical contact for financial transaction research and process improvement initiatives
· Manage multiple banking and investment broker relationships
· Manage and respond to banking requested documentation, including for international and domestic account openings and KYC compliance
· Manage bank account and investment reconciliations and reporting
· Create and maintain treasury control documentation
· Oversee Letter of Credit/Bank Guarantee/Bond application processing
· Provide financial audit support
